We investigated the laryngeal closure pressure during sustained phonation in five healthy adult men with no pathological lesions in the glottis using a round pressure transducer with a diameter of 10 mm and a thickness of 1 mm. The transducer was placed between the vocal processes through the mouth. Subjects were asked to utter a sustained phonation of the vowel sound /eh/ at varying pitch and intensity in modal register. The laryngeal closure pressure ranged from 0 to 200 cmH(2)O. At a comfortable pitch and intensity, the pressure was below 50 cmH(2)O. The pressure was correlated with pitch, but not with intensity.
